      The story follows Sol and Connie Blink as they move to Grand Creek and encounter their eccentric neighbor, Fay Holaderry, and her dog Swift, who possesses a suspicious bone. Sol, possessing advanced knowledge for his age, recognizes the bone as a human femur, prompting him and Connie to suspect that Fay may be involved in something sinister. This intriguing premise sets the stage for a mystery that challenges the young duo to uncover the truth about their unsettling new neighbor.
